NExt ...
50mm prime SMC Pentax FA 1.4 BLACK - this works on manual on the
istD and kinda worked on auto focus but not properly ... apparently
it works on later issues -- or some (a brief check on ebay) With
operating manual from 1991.
Let me know what you want for it...
Let me do some more digging :-) I guess you know this lens ..
It's the same as all the Pentax 50mm f1.4 lenses but in FA livery,
(Ok, so they were supposedly tweeked, and they have the best coatings
Pentax put in the focal length). I've been looking for nice short
portrait tele for the K20d that takes full advantage of the
automation. The f1.4's aren't perfect but they're more than good
enough. I find that I don't end up using the M50 f1.4 on the K20d, I
used to use it a lot on the D and Ds.
